#1a94f0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a94f0 is composed of 10.2% red, 58%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.2% cyan, 38.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 205.8 degrees, a saturation of 87.7% and a lightness of 52.2%. #1a94f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#34ffff with #0029e1.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

Shades and Tints of #1a94f0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01060a is the darkest color, while #f7fb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a94f0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#818689 is the less saturated color, while #1195f9 is the most saturated one.
